Fees and Cost Over Time

ANGU charges 0.10% per year while SCHD charges 0.06%. On a $10,000 position that is $10 vs $6 annually, a gap of $4 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, ANGU currently yields 0.00% against 3.00% for SCHD.

Holdings Overlap

ANGU already in SCHD6.7%
SCHD already in ANGU49.0%

6.7% of ANGU's money is in holdings SCHD also owns. 49.0% of SCHD's money is in holdings ANGU also owns.

The two portfolios partly overlap.

18 positions in common, counted across the 239 positions we hold weights for in ANGU and 100 in SCHD, against full books of 239 and 103.

What only one of them owns

Our book lists 81 positions for SCHD that do not appear in our book for ANGU (50.9% of the fund), and 215 for ANGU that do not appear in SCHD (92.2%).

Some of those will be the same company recorded under a different code in one of the two books, so the real difference in what you would own is no larger than this and may be smaller. We do not name the individual positions here for that reason.
